Ticket BRV-2291 — Digest scheduler signature failure

Batch email digests from Larkspool stopped at 02:10. Scheduler rejected the cron bundle: signature check failed after last night's rotation. Old key was revoked but the new one never landed in the runner config. Fix: drop the new key into the scheduler's trust file and restart the batch worker. Current valid signing key follows.

rollout seal: bky4_DFM9

FINANCE REVIEW SUMMARY — Dravenor Industries

Subject: Retirement of the Quillstone product line.

Quillstone posted negative contribution margin for four consecutive quarters. Wind-down cost estimated at 1.2M, recoverable within 18 months through reduced warehousing and tooling disposal. Remaining inventory to clear via the Ostlund channel at discount. No material write-downs beyond reserves already booked. Board approval requested this cycle. Strategic rationale is appended below.

internal memo for yahag-hahig: Belwynix Group plans to lower the Silir list price by 62 percent in May.

### Action Item: Spoolhaven Retry Storm

From last Tuesday's outage: the Spoolhaven print service retried failed jobs without backoff, saturating the render pool. Fix merged; retries now use capped exponential backoff with jitter. Owner will monitor for a week before closing. The agreed retry constants are recorded below.

constants for yadup-kajof:
RATE_LIMITS = {
    "zorwyn": 1,
    "druwyn": 1,
}

## Runbook: Quietknot dedupe pipeline

If your plugin's alerts aren't collapsing, first check that your fingerprint function is deterministic — Quietknot hashes whatever you return, so timestamps in there will wreck dedupe. Plugin authors get a sandbox tenant on the Bramblehost cluster; suppression windows there are capped at five minutes to keep testing fast. To register your plugin and push test alerts into the sandbox, call the enrollment endpoint with the key below.

service key, fawip-bajef: kto11_Qt5wZK9vdNC

## Onboarding: Fernpress template rendering

Fernpress caches compiled templates per tenant; cold renders cost ~40ms, warm renders under 2ms. Never bypass the cache in production — the benchmarks in the perf dashboard assume it. Precompiled template bundles are built nightly on the Ashgrove box and must be signed before upload. When setting up your build environment, configure the signer with the key below.

signing key of bagap-yawep = bky13_TbfT6ZMUoGJo2